Inspirational leadership plays a pivotal role in driving organizational success. To effectively inspire and motivate teams, leaders must cultivate the set of core attributes that empower them to guide their colleagues towards shared goals. First and foremost, integrity acts as the foundation for trust and credibility. Leaders who consistently demonstrate ethical conduct gain the respect and confidence of their followers.

Furthermore, effective communication skills are essential for conveying a clear vision, fostering open dialogue, and offering constructive feedback. Leaders who possess strong communication skills can successfully connect with their teams on a personal level, building lasting relationships based on trust and understanding.

Ultimately, a passion for growth and development should be at the heart of every inspirational leader. By supporting their team members to hone their skills and attain their full potential, leaders can create a culture of continuous improvement and innovation.

Impart The 7 Traits of a Transformational Leader

Transformational leadership is a powerful force that can ignite positive change within organizations and individuals alike. These leaders possess a unique set of traits that distinguish them as exceptional motivators and visionaries. Explore delve into the seven key traits that define a truly transformational leader:

  • Inspiring Vision: Transformational leaders possess a clear vision for the future and effectively communicate it to their followers, motivating them to strive for excellence.
  • Empowering Others: They believe in the potential of their team members and constantly empower them to take ownership and contribute.
  • Proactive Listening: Transformational leaders are keen listeners who value the perspectives of others. They foster an environment where open communication and feedback are welcomed.
  • Honesty: Their actions demonstrate their values, building trust and respect among their followers.
  • Resilience: They overcome challenges with strength, serving as a example of resilience for their team.
  • Introspection: Transformational leaders recognize their own strengths and weaknesses, regularly seeking to develop.
  • Visionary: They demonstrate a comprehensive understanding of the big picture and develop plans that lead to long-term success.

Evolve From Manager to Mentor: Building Inspiring Leadership Skills

True leadership isn't about directing teams; it's about fostering their growth. To make this change, managers must transform into mentors, offering guidance and support that empowers individuals to succeed. This evolution requires a alteration in mindset, focusing on teamwork and development rather than supervision.

  • Engaging leaders appreciate the unique strengths and aspirations of each team member.
  • Successful mentors proactively hear to their mentees, sharing constructive guidance that supports growth.
  • Guidance goes beyond projects; it's about fostering a environment of trust and transparency where individuals feel supported.

Cultivating this kind of mentorship requires a authentic commitment to see others thrive. It's a fulfilling journey that significantly impacts both the individual and the team as a whole.
